We watched Tokyo Godfathers. It sounds like some sort of crime movie, and sure, there are Yakuza involved, but only peripherally. In fact, it is an animé Christmas movie set amongst Tokyo's homeless, in a style similar to all those Hollywood or English Christmas movies like Love Actually only grittier and consequently when the humour comes it's funnier. It's a feel good movie that isn't afraid to tackle subjects that are almost taboo in Japan, the homeless and those with AIDS.

This is the movie you want to show people who think animé is all about short-skirted school girls and mecha. It could have easily been made as a live action movie, that it is animé is completely irrelevant to the fact that it is a great little movie. I'd recommend it as something the Princess' movie watchers should see, even if they don't normally do animé.

I won't say anymore so it doesn't ruin your enjoyment of the movie, but it is up there with the best of "serious" animé.
